Abstract :
[en] The safety and durability of each construction depends primarily on the accuracy of the weld joint. Therefore, it is very important to join the metals without any defects. This study focuses on finding defects in a weld by determining the depth and size of these defects. Experimental work of welding is made in the form of a simple V-groove which we have inspected and analyzed by phased array ultrasonic testing method. This research allowed us to realize that the technique is much better compared to that based on conventional welding, same as to observe that it maximizes structural safety.
